Digital currencies on Steemit

Steemit has 3 different digital currencies that it operates on

  1. STEEM tokens that can be traded on exchanges for BTC, ETH, LTC ect

  2. STEEM Power (SP) measures your influence levels. The more influences you have the more you can influence comments and posts

  3. STEEM Dollars (SBD) are liquid stable currency tokens that are pegged to the $1 USD. This can be transferred between users and also used to buy things in the market place. Most commonly you can find STEEM dollars under posts indicating how much money a post has earned.

How do people make money on steemit

You can make money with 3 ways on Steemit.

  1. Posting: by creating content in the form of posts you can earn upvotes (likes if your familiar with Facebook) from community members. Depending on the upvotes you ill receive a portion of the ongoing STEEM reward Pool. Currently the percentage is 75% for authors and 25% for curators (people who upvote posts) of content. however this is timing sensitive.

You can also earn money from comments if they are upvoted.

  1. Voting and curating - If you discover a post and upvote it before it becomes popular, you can earn a curation reward. The reward amount will depend on the amount of STEEM Power you have.

  2. Purchasing - Users can purchase STEEM or Steem Dollar tokens directly through the Steemit wallet using bitcoin, Ether, or BitShares tokens. They are also available from other markets and exchanges including BlockTrades, Poloniex, Bittrex, Shapeshift.io, and Changelly. STEEM tokens that are powered up to STEEM Power earn a small amount of interest for holding.
